Send us a Message [https://www.buzzsprout.com/2315930/fan_mail/new] Most healthcare leaders think about retention as something that happens after someone is hired. But what if your hiring process itself is either building or quietly eroding your culture? In this episode, Sue Tetzlaff sits down with Capstone Transformational Expert Julie Coneset to talk about one of the most consequential — and often most stressful — responsibilities healthcare leaders carry: hiring the right people. Julie brings decades of experience in rural healthcare human resources and organizational transformation to a candid conversation about what separates strategic hiring from desperation hiring, and why that distinction matters more than most leaders realize. You'll hear practical wisdom on: * Why lowering your hiring bar during a staffing shortage almost always costs more than it saves * How behavioral-based interview techniques help you predict fit and performance before day one * Why peer panel interviews can transform how your team shows up for onboarding — and beyond * What employer-of-choice organizations do differently when it comes to attracting and selecting candidates * How your hiring decisions today directly shape your overtime costs, burnout levels, and traveler reliance tomorrow Interested in strengthening retention, culture, leadership, and hiring practices in your organization?
